Director: Giles Foster

Cast: Katharine Schlesinger, Peter Firth, Robert Hardy

Year: 1987

Duration: 88 mins

Certificate: PG

Continuing our extended season marking the 250th anniversary of Jane Austen's birth, this charming adaptation of one of her less prominent novels will be introduced by Austen experts from De Montfort University. Originally made by the BBC to show as part of their Screen Two anthology series, Northanger Abbey is the story of Catherine Morland, a sheltered young woman who escapes into her imagination by reading Gothic novels. Invited to Bath by family friends, Cathy finds herself falling for clergyman Henry Tilney.
